Vital ways of getting immediate affiliate commissions.
One of the easiest ways of starting an online business and earning quick profits is through affiliate marketing. With no website to develop, no product development to achieve, no refunds or customer problems to deal with, this is by far the most effective way of developing your online presence.
If you already have your affiliate products and you’re working at making more sales, an increase in commissions is the obvious goal of everyone. With more and more products hitting the online market, it’s essential to follow some simple yet crucial steps. So what are they?
If you want your affiliate program commissions to take off, literally overnight, these are the steps you need to seriously consider;
1. Do your research and check out the programs you’re thinking about promoting. It’s pretty obvious that you only want to promote a product that will give you the maximum paycheck in the shortest possible time.
The main factors to consider when doing this are obvious when you stop and think about them, but more often than not, are not fully considered before putting your time and money into making your product pay.
Check the commission structure and make sure it pays well. Also, try to find products that match your target audience and are already paying well to other affiliates. You soon know when a program isn’t meeting up to its promises – that’s the time to reconsider its worth and move on to the next.
As you’re probably going to be one of many affiliates promoting the same product, especially if it’s a good one, establish your USP – or ‘Unique Selling Position’. Set yourself up as offering that little something extra that makes you stand out above the crowd.
Write a short article to give away as an incentive to potential buyers. This gives you both greater credibility and extra drawing power.
Give information that’s not only free but useful. When you do this, if what you give away for free is good, people naturally expect a great deal more from the bought product. Make recommendations about the product within the report if you can, and try to give just enough information to make people need the actual product.
2. When giving away free reports or ebooks, save and collect, at the very least, the name and email addresses of all those who download your gift. It’s now widely known that very few people purchase their first introduction to a product.
This is where an autoresponder is invaluable as you can create a whole series of follow-up messages to send to these prospects to entice them into buying your product. Anywhere between 6 and 10 messages are needed to finally clinch the sale, so automate this process and capitalize on the free report.
Once you have these prospect's details, they are yours until the person unsubscribes. This means that you can send them information in the months ahead about other products you’re promoting, long after they’ve bought the original item.
If you develop an ezine, you are in a perfect position to send more valuable, and occasional free, information to these prospects who now value you as a source of knowledge and useful recommendations. You develop a relationship with them and they may stay with you for years to come. They begin to trust you and your recommendations and eventually, are likely to buy from you again.
3. Never underestimate the power of negotiation. Be prepared to haggle with a seller whose goods you wish to promote. Remember that all merchants need affiliates to market and sell their goods and will be more inclined to change their payment structure than potentially lose business if they see you as a good source of income.
Be bold and you could find yourself receiving a greater slice of the pie for all your advertising efforts. Don’t be greedy but be fair and you will be respected for it.
4. Use effective advertising techniques. ‘Pay Per Click’ will give you the most immediate results if you do your research right. Naturally, Google’s Adwords and Overture are the places to start, being leaders in the online PPC field. But, look around and research the smaller players who offer cheaper rates to a smaller audience. These include; ExcelSeek, JumpFind, LookQuick to name just three.
Ezine Top Sponsor and Solo ads can also give you a huge and quick return on your advertising buck with your ad being received by a responsive audience of your chosen market. And as with any advertising campaign – track your results. If you don’t know who’s clicking what, you’ll never know which ads are working.
Use these techniques and you’ll soon see an immediate improvement in your affiliate sales. Build on your successes and expansion and growth will follow.
Keep affiliates motivated.
Running affiliate programs is easier than ever with the software and help available now. However, keeping your affiliates motivated and selling isn’t quite as easy to do. If the success of your business rests upon how your affiliates perform, you want to provide them with the right tools to get the job done successfully. If you are already running an affiliate program for your products, you should know that a large number of people who sign up for your program are never to be heard from again. You can, however, reduce the number of nonproductive affiliates by remaining in touch with them constantly. Remind them of their usernames and passwords, and tell them where to log in to check their stats or get creative. Always keep them informed of new product lines or changes in policy or procedures. The key to motivation is making sure that you stay in touch. Always pay attention to who your top sellers are, and make sure that you contact them regularly. Pay attention to who your worst producers are, and make sure you stay in touch with them constantly as well. The main reason most affiliates don’t perform that well is that they don’t possess any leadership or guidance. This can easily be changed by writing a marketing course, which you can even offer for sale to nonaffiliates, although you should make it available to your affiliates at no charge. Keep your creatives and sales copy up to date. You should also provide new material for your affiliates to use regularly. Providing them with nothing but a text link and one banner just doesn’t generate much excitement at all. Provide your affiliates with sales letters, reviews, ads, banners of different shapes and sizes, and
anything else that comes to mind. Be sure that your affiliates know the material is there for them to use. Always listen to your affiliates, and get the proper feedback on your material. You should also hold virtual meetings. Set up chat rooms where your affiliates can attend virtual meetings every week. Be sure to answer any questions, have motivated speakers, and do anything else you can think of to make the meetings more motivated.
Given your affiliates, the credit they deserve is also very important. Each month, you should give credit to the best performers in your affiliate newsletter. Give small bonuses to those that perform well, and you can even set up a payment structure that rewards higher commissions and bigger volumes of sales.
Always make sure you do everything you can to help your affiliates succeed and make money in your program. If they are making money – you are succeeding and making money as well. In reality, their success is your success.
